Most of my read messages are deleted automatically, although in the menu It says to never delete read messages until I say so. In consequence, I have lost most of my read messages. Though strangely, not in all the folders - just the important ones!
All the read messages in my in box are deleted as soon as I read them and move off the message. All the read "keep its, important information" have been deleted, but not the Tescos offers folder. AAArgh. Can anybody help me please?
